HASLEMERE Town Mayor Brian Howard has promised to work on finding a tenant for the former Lo-Cost supermarket site in the High Street after plans by a local business to take over the building fell through.

Speaking at the annual town meeting last week, Mr Howard said that plans had been made by Stuart Jay, who runs the Land of Nod in Lower Street, to move into the building, but that the plug had been pulled on the deal at the last minute.
